Stent-in-stent through a side hole to prevent biliary metallicstent migration

World J Gastrointest Endosc. 2011 Mar 16;3(3):64-6. doi: 10.4253/wjge.v3.i3.64.

Abstract

The covered self-expandable metallic stent (SEMS) has been developed to overcome the problem of tissue in-growth, However, stent migration is a well-known com--plication of covered SEMS placement. Use of a double pigtail stent to lock the movement of the SEMS and prevent migration has been advised by many ex-perts. Unfortunately, in our case this technique led to an in-cidental upward migration of the SEMS. We used APC to create a side hole in the SEMS for plastic stent insertion as stent-in-stent. This led to a successful pre-ven-tion of stent migration.
